What Are Magnetic Platens?
Have you ever wondered how certain tools and technologies manage to hold things together so securely without the fuss of traditional clamping? Enter Magnetic Platens! These ingenious devices use powerful magnets to create an unyielding grip on materials, making them essential in various applications.
The Power of Magnetic Forces
Magnetic platens leverage the principles of magnetism to bond surfaces. Imagine needing to secure a metal sheet for cutting or engraving; instead of fiddling around with clamps and screws, a magnetic platen does the job in a snap! This not only speeds up the process but also ensures precision and safety.
Diverse Applications
From manufacturing to art, the uses of magnetic platens are as varied as they are fascinating. Here are just a few arenas where these magnetic marvels shine:
1. Manufacturing
In industries like automotive or aerospace, precision is everything. Magnetic platens allow for high-speed machining by holding parts securely in place. This minimizes movement during complex operations, leading to higher quality outcomes.
2. Sign Making
Ever seen those impressive signboards with intricate designs? Magnetic platens play a significant role in the creation process, holding materials steady while cutting or printing. This ensures that every detail is crisp and clear, much to the delight of clients.
3. Art and Design
Artists and designers often need to work with various materials. Magnetic platens make it easier to switch between mediums without losing time. They can be used in printmaking, sculpture, and even during installations, allowing creators to focus on their craft rather than setup.
Advantages of Using Magnetic Platens
Why should you consider incorporating magnetic platens into your workflow? Well, let's break it down:
- Speed: Setup time is drastically reduced, allowing for quicker project turnaround.
- Flexibility: Easily switch between different materials and sizes without the hassle of traditional clamps.
- Precision: Maintain tight tolerances, which is crucial in high-stakes manufacturing.
- Safety: Reduce the risk of accidents caused by loose clamps or shifting materials.
Challenges and Considerations
Of course, like any tool, magnetic platens come with a few challenges. They require a clean surface for optimal performance, and not all materials are compatible. It's important to assess your needs and material types before jumping in.
